Definitions of second word
- adjective second next after the first; being the ordinal number for two. 1
- adjective second being the latter of two equal parts. 1
- adjective second next after the first in place, time, or value: the second house from the corner. 1
- adjective second next after the first in rank, grade, degree, status, or importance: the second person in the company. 1
- adjective second alternate: I have my hair cut every second week. 1
- adjective second inferior. 1

Origin of second
First appearance:
before 1250 One of the 11% oldest English words
1250-1300; Middle English (adj., noun and adv.) < Old French (adj.) < Latin secundus following, next, second, equivalent to sec- (base of sequī to follow) + -undus adj. suffix
